Small Circular Rep-Encoding Single-Stranded DNA Genomes in Peruvian Diarrhea Virome

Descripción del Articulo

Metagenomic analysis of diarrhea samples revealed the presence of numerous human enteric viruses and small circular Rep-encoding single-stranded DNA (CRESS-DNA) genomes. One such genome was related to smacoviruses, while eight others were related to genomes reported in the feces of different mammals...
